Sec. 1651.13  How to apply for a death benefit.

    In order for a deceased participant's account to be disbursed, the 
TSP record keeper must receive Form TSP-17, Application for Account 
Balance of Deceased Participant. Any potential beneficiary or other 
individual can file Form TSP-17 with the TSP record keeper. The 
individual submitting Form TSP-17 must attach a copy of a certified 
death certificate of the participant to the application. The acceptance 
of an application by the TSP record keeper does not entitle the 
applicant to benefits.
